Why Hiring a Licensed Electrician Matters

Electricity isn’t something to take lightly. Poorly done wiring, overloaded circuits, or even simple outlet installations can turn into fire hazards if handled improperly. A licensed electrician has gone through the proper education and apprenticeship, passed necessary exams, and continually stays updated with local and national electrical codes. This expertise ensures that whether you're installing a new light fixture, upgrading your electrical panel, or rewiring your entire property, the work is done safely and up to standard.

In Renton, Washington — like many cities across the U.S. — local regulations require permits and inspections for most electrical work. A licensed electrician knows how to navigate these requirements and can pull the appropriate permits, ensuring your project complies with city codes and doesn’t become a liability when it’s time to sell your home.

Common Services Offered by Licensed Electricians in Renton

Renton property owners rely on licensed electricians for a wide range of residential and commercial services. These typically include:

- Electrical Panel Upgrades: If your panel is outdated or you're adding significant load (like an EV charger or hot tub), it’s crucial to upgrade to a modern panel that can handle today’s demands.

- Whole-Home Wiring & Rewiring: Whether you’re renovating an older home or building a new one, professional wiring ensures safety and reliability.

- Lighting Installation: From recessed lighting to outdoor illumination, an electrician can help design and install systems that fit your space and preferences.

- Outlet & Switch Upgrades: Modern devices need modern infrastructure. Replacing two-prong outlets with grounded ones, installing dimmer switches, or adding USB charging ports is all part of what licensed electricians do every day.

- Safety Inspections & Troubleshooting: Concerned about flickering lights or outlets that spark? A licensed electrician will conduct a thorough inspection and offer solutions to ensure your home is safe.

- Generator Installation: Power outages can happen anytime, especially during storms. A licensed electrician can install backup generators that keep your essentials running.

- Smart Home Integration: From smart thermostats to advanced security systems, licensed electricians in Renton are increasingly called upon to bring added convenience and connectivity to local homes.

How to Know You're Working with a True Licensed Electrician

Here’s what to look for when hiring someone for an electrical job in Renton:

- License Verification: Legitimate electricians will provide their Washington State license number. You can verify it online through the Department of Labor & Industries.

- Insurance Coverage: A licensed electrician should have liability insurance and worker’s comp to protect you and their team.

- Written Estimates & Contracts: Transparency is key. You should receive detailed quotes, a timeline for the work, and a breakdown of what’s included.

- Guaranteed Workmanship: Skilled electricians back their work with warranties or service guarantees. This reflects confidence in their craftsmanship and materials.

- Strong Local Reviews: Customer feedback matters. Check Google, Yelp, and local directories for consistent, positive reviews from Renton homeowners and businesses.
